What companies run services between Pontefract, England and Warrington, England?

TransPennine Express operates a train from Wakefield Kirkgate to Manchester Piccadilly hourly. Tickets cost £14–24 and the journey takes 1h 4m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Stuart Road B to St Elphin's Park via Leeds City Bus & Coach Station, Manchester Central Coach Station, Charlotte Street, and The Trafford Centre Bus Station in around 4h 51m.
